East European University (EEU), located in Tbilisi, Georgia, is a recognized private university committed to delivering high-quality education aligned with international standards. Established with a vision to create a modern educational environment based on the principles of democracy, innovation, and academic excellence, EEU has quickly emerged as a trusted destination for international students pursuing medical education. Authorized in 2012 by the Ministry of Education and Science of Georgia, EEU offers accredited programs that meet global academic and professional standards. The Medical Doctor (MD) program is designed according to international medical education frameworks, taught entirely in English, with modern teaching methodologies including interactive learning, simulation-based training, and clinical practice. One of the key strengths of EEU is its highly qualified faculty — experienced Georgian and international professors, medical practitioners, and researchers — ensuring students receive both theoretical knowledge and practical insights essential for a successful medical career. Recognized by NMC (India), WHO, WDOMS, FAIMER, ECFMG, and WFME, EEU stands out as one of the preferred universities offering quality medical education in Georgia.

The Clinical and Practical Skills Development Center, on the basis of the Faculty of Healthcare Sciences, carries out its functions equipped with the latest technologies in accordance with modern standards of medical education — guided by University regulations, educational programme requirements, and regulations of the center.
The goal of the Center is to develop research, clinical and practical skills for students of the higher education programme carried out at the Faculty, and to prepare qualified and competitive graduates.
